Output ae4e58efc75dd4ec068b0c47a86af9179e56f58dba66756a6a45fb852be84160:3

value
1703698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759b9684da11449b97728c330ba93371dce85951 OP_EQUAL
address
MJd1gKG71voTYqkgjFfZ8fZirp9AauyZ8x
transaction
ae4e58efc75dd4ec068b0c47a86af9179e56f58dba66756a6a45fb852be84160
spent
true